Leaders are turning to 360 Feedback to build a robust pipeline of future managers.
Emeryville, Calif. – 3D Group, an industry trailblazer in 360 Feedback and leadership development, is pleased to announce the results of the seventh edition of its industry benchmark study, Current Practices in 360 Feedback. Relying upon data compiled over the last 20 years, respondents revealed 360 Feedback is one of the primary strategies used by leaders to develop and retain high potential employees and to help make better decisions for the health of their companies.
“Our survey results show 360 Feedback continues to be used primarily as a developmental tool,” explains Dale Rose, founder and Chief Executive Officer of 3D Group. “What is most exciting about our latest survey is leaders are now incorporating the practice to support talent and human capital decisions that will positively impact the future of their businesses.”
For the latest study, 3D Group surveyed and interviewed 360 Feedback process owners from companies of all sizes, representing 18 different industries. An overwhelming majority of senior leaders supported 360 Feedback, including 78 percent of Chief Executive Officers and 87 percent of Chief Human Resources Officers. For the seventh edition, 3D Group added several new questions about business value and the reputation of 360 Feedback, including a breakdown of how strongly specific senior leaders support the practice, which business metrics are most impacted, and how organizations approach ROI. Current findings also looked back on how the pandemic changed 360 Feedback processes.
